What is CloudWays?

Cloudways is a managed cloud hosting platform that simplifies the deployment and management of web applications. It allows users to host websites on top cloud infrastructure providers like DigitalOcean, AWS, Google Cloud, Linode, and Vultr without dealing with the complexities of server setup. Cloudways offers one-click application installations, automatic scaling, performance monitoring, and a user-friendly control panel.

Users can easily manage server configurations, monitor performance metrics, and scale resources as needed. The platform aims to provide a balance between the flexibility of cloud hosting and the ease of use associated with shared hosting, making it an attractive option for developers and businesses seeking a hassle-free hosting solution.

1. Kinsta

Kinsta is a premium managed WordPress hosting provider known for its high-performance infrastructure and focus on delivering exceptional service to WordPress users. Leveraging the Google Cloud Platform, Kinsta offers a robust and scalable hosting environment specifically optimized for WordPress sites. The platform provides features such as automatic daily backups, staging environments, and a custom-designed dashboard for easy management. Kinsta places a strong emphasis on security, with measures like isolated containers for each site, DDoS detection, and hardware firewalls. The hosting environment is built for speed, utilizing Google Cloud’s infrastructure and advanced technologies.

2. DigitalOcean

DigitalOcean is a cloud infrastructure provider that offers scalable and developer-friendly solutions. Known for its simplicity and cost-effectiveness, DigitalOcean provides virtual servers (Droplets) with various configurations to accommodate diverse project needs. Users can easily deploy, manage, and scale applications in the cloud using DigitalOcean’s intuitive control panel and robust API. The platform offers features such as SSD-based storage, straightforward pricing, and a variety of pre-configured one-click applications to streamline development processes. DigitalOcean caters to both individual developers and businesses, providing a reliable and accessible cloud computing environment for hosting websites, applications, and other online services.

3. SiteGround

SiteGround is a popular web hosting company known for its reliable and user-friendly hosting solutions. Catering to a diverse range of users, from individuals to small businesses and enterprises, SiteGround offers shared hosting, cloud hosting, and dedicated server hosting services. The platform provides features like SSD storage, free SSL certificates, automatic daily backups, and a custom caching system to optimize website performance. SiteGround is renowned for its excellent customer support, which includes a 24/7 live chat, phone support, and a comprehensive knowledge base.

4. A2 Hosting

A2 Hosting is a web hosting provider known for its emphasis on speed, reliability, and developer-friendly features. Offering a range of hosting services, including shared hosting, VPS hosting, and dedicated hosting, A2 Hosting is recognized for its high-performance SwiftServer platform. This platform incorporates technologies like SSDs, Turbo Servers, and A2 Optimized software to deliver faster website loading times. A2 Hosting supports a variety of programming languages and frameworks, making it suitable for a diverse range of websites and applications. The hosting plans come with features such as free SSL certificates, automatic backups, and a user-friendly control panel. A2 Hosting also has a reputation for excellent customer support, providing 24/7 assistance via live chat, phone, and ticketing systems.

5. Vultr

Vultr is a cloud infrastructure provider known for delivering high-performance, reliable, and affordable cloud computing solutions. Like DigitalOcean, Vultr offers virtual servers, known as instances, focusing on simplicity and flexibility. Users can choose from a variety of compute instances, each tailored to specific performance requirements. Vultr provides SSD-backed storage, a user-friendly control panel, and a straightforward pricing model without hidden fees. The platform supports a global network of data centers, allowing users to deploy their applications closer to their target audience for optimized performance. Vultr is popular among developers for its ease of use, transparent pricing, and ability to deploy servers quickly, making it a competitive choice for hosting a wide range of applications and services in the cloud.

6. Linode – Best Cloudways Alternatives

Linode is a reputable cloud hosting provider that offers virtual private servers (Linode instances) with a focus on simplicity, reliability, and performance. Users can deploy and manage scalable infrastructure using Linode’s intuitive control panel or interact with the platform through its API. Linode provides a variety of instance types to cater to different workloads and applications. With data centers located in various regions globally, users can strategically place their resources to enhance performance and reduce latency. Linode is known for its straightforward pricing structure, which includes hourly and monthly billing options, without hidden fees.

7. AWS (Amazon Web Services)

Amazon Web Services (AWS) is a comprehensive and widely used cloud computing platform provided by Amazon. AWS offers a vast array of scalable and on-demand cloud services, including computing power, storage, databases, machine learning, analytics, networking, and more. It provides a highly reliable, secure, and flexible infrastructure that allows businesses and developers to build and deploy applications quickly and efficiently. AWS’s global network of data centers enables users to host applications and services closer to end-users, improving performance.

8. Google Cloud Platform (GCP)

Google Cloud Platform (GCP) is a comprehensive suite of cloud computing services offered by Google. GCP provides a wide range of scalable and flexible solutions for computing, storage, databases, machine learning, data analytics, and more. With a global network of data centers, users can deploy and manage applications and services with low latency and high performance. GCP leverages Google’s infrastructure and technology, including its expertise in data processing and machine learning, to offer innovative and advanced solutions. The platform is known for its strong focus on data analytics, big data processing, and machine learning capabilities through services like BigQuery and TensorFlow.

9. Azure (Microsoft Azure)

Microsoft Azure, commonly known as Azure, is a comprehensive cloud computing platform provided by Microsoft. Azure offers a vast array of services for computing, storage, databases, networking, analytics, artificial intelligence, and more. It enables businesses and developers to build, deploy, and manage applications and services in a scalable and flexible environment. With a global network of data centers, Azure allows users to deploy resources closer to their end-users, improving performance and reducing latency. Azure is closely integrated with Microsoft’s products and services, making it an attractive choice for organizations already using Microsoft technologies.

10. Heroku – Best Cloudways Alternatives

Heroku is a cloud platform as a service (PaaS) that simplifies the deployment, management, and scaling of applications. Acquired by Salesforce, Heroku is particularly known for its ease of use and developer-friendly approach. It supports various programming languages and frameworks, allowing developers to build, deploy, and scale applications without worrying about infrastructure management. Heroku provides a platform where developers can focus on writing code, while the platform handles tasks such as provisioning servers, scaling resources, and managing databases. It supports a wide range of add-ons and extensions for additional functionalities, such as databases, caching, and monitoring.
